Stimulants are the most commonly used type of medication prescribed by healthcare professionals for ADHD. They boost the amount of neurotransmitters that help you control your impulsivity and focus in your brain.

iampsychiatry-logo-wide.pngThey are available as immediate-release and extended-release tablets, or as chewable or liquid adhd medication uk forms. Short-acting stimulants can last from six to eight hours while long-acting ones last up to 16 hours.

Adderall

Adderall is a central nervous system stimulant that contains the active ingredients amphetamine and dextroamphetamine. It is prescribed to treat ADHD and other attention deficit disorders (ADHD) as well as the condition known as narcolepsy. It works by altering the quantities of certain natural substances within the brain, such as dopamine and norepinephrine. It also has been proven to reduce appetite.

It is a controlled drug and is only available under the supervision of a doctor. It is available in tablet and extended-release capsule forms. It is typically prescribed in a dosage of five to 30 milligrams, and the dosage is modified on a weekly basis until it reaches the desired results. It is important to know that this medication may cause adverse effects including insomnia, stomach pain and headaches. In rare instances, it could increase the heart rate or blood pressure.

Evekeo

Evekeo is a brand new prescription medication approved for treatment of ADHD. It also treats narcolepsy and obesity. It is believed to help to treat ADHD symptoms by altering the levels of neurotransmitters within the brain. This drug is a stimulant, and it can cause sleep disturbances, nervousness, and high blood pressure. The DEA classifies this drug as a Schedule II controlled substance, which means it is a risk for dependence and addiction. It is important to talk with your physician prior to taking this medication.

Tell your doctor if you are taking any other medication, especially if you have heart issues or high blood pressure. These medications may interact with Evekeo and lead to an increase in blood pressure or heart rate. It is important to inform your doctor if you have had an attack or stroke. The use of stimulants can increase the risk of a stroke or heart attack.
